Location
Culliss House B&B sits a few minutes' walk from Inverness Castle and the River Ness. This central location offers an easy base for guests looking to explore the Highland surroundings, including Loch Ness and the historic Culloden Battlefield. Visitors can appreciate local attractions and amenities within walking distance.
Rooms
The hotel offers three tastefully decorated double rooms, each equipped with en-suite bathrooms. Guests can choose from rooms that accommodate their needs, including one with both shower and bath options. Each room also includes hospitality trays and Freeview TV.
Dining
Culliss House B&B provides a home-cooked breakfast made from fresh ingredients, served each morning to guests. Special diets are catered for, ensuring that all preferences are met. The breakfast service adds a personal touch to the stay.
Local Attractions
The B&B is an excellent gateway to explore the Highland area, including famous sites like Cawdor Castle and Eilean Donan Castle. Adventurous travelers can embark on the North Coast 500 route, a celebrated scenic tour showcasing Scotland's captivating landscapes. Inverness itself offers shopping, art galleries, and a variety of culinary experiences.
